Extra bikes, cars and people on the roads
Police are reminding people about road safety during TT after a handful of accidents yesterday.
1,500 extra bikes are expected on the Island this year, and the roads are set to be extremely busy with numbers of visitors close to the levels seen during 2007's centenary year.
With that in mind, officers are asking anyone using the roads during TT this year to be extra careful.
Saturday, the first day of practice sessions on the TT circuit, saw a small number of accidents.
